It is the student’s responsibility, in consultation with the Senior Tutor, to find suitable placement for training. The student should be under the supervision of an attorney- at- law with at least five years’ experience in practice, who is in good standing in the profession. In awarding the Legal Education Certificate, account is taken of the student’s performance on the In -Service Training programme. Students in the Six Month Programme are also required to undertake a period of In-Service Training. It is the responsibility of the student to identify a suitable placement for training, in consultation with the Senior Tutor. In-Service Training may be undertaken during the six- months period of the course of study. 6. EXEMPTION FROM SUBJECTS IN COURSE OF STUDY: (i) Six Month Programme Course of Study Pursuant to Regulation 48(2), students registered on the Six-Month Programme may make an application for an exemption from a subject by submitting a signed letter, addressed to the Principal, with appropriate supporting documents, as soon as possible after completing the registration process. In any event, the application must be made no later than the end of the first week in October of each academic year. No application for exemption will be accepted after that period. An exemption from Law Office Management Accounting and Technology (LOMAT), requires a student to demonstrate that they have: i. significant practical exposure to Law Office Management; ii. handled client accounts and client funds; iii. submitted to regulatory supervisors, including demonstrating an understanding of proceeds of crime legislation, providing reports in a timely manner and demonstrating having operated an appropriate infrastructure to provide same.
